All 1,500 practical care facilities maintain digital health documents. Nevertheless, as a result of government personal privacy regulations, they do not share them with anybody without your fine. You require to guide the clinic to ahead the records of your see to your primary doctor.
- These healthcare providers are walk-in facilities setup inside of bigger stores like Walmart and also Target or, possibly much more commonly, at drug stores like Walgreens and CVS.
- Thus, they staffnurse professionals (NPs) or physician aides () instead of even more costly medical professionals and they often tend to focus on a little less advanced medical treatments than an urgent treatment center.
- Most of these places are made to be affordable as well as effective as possible.

Book Online Urgent care facility, walk-in clinic, immediate care clinic, retail clinic, convenient care facility; the terms are used often mutually nowadays.
Immediate care delay times for walk-in clients ordinary mins. Immediate treatment facilities will avert patients that do not have insurance or money at the time of service. An immediate care facility is one level more advanced than a retail center and they team and gear up accordingly. For example, most urgent treatment areas contend least one clinical doctor on staff and have the doctor offered to see clients any time the doors are open. That said, you might still see a nurse practitioner or physician assistant as opposed to a medical professional.
